Clare Councillors heading state side for Patrick’s Day insist its money well spent

The Mayor of Clare feels the cost of sending local representatives and Council officials to the US for St. Patrick’s Day is money well spent.

Ennis Councillor Pat Daly along with the county manager is to visit Chicago and New York,  while representatives from Ennis, Shannon and Kilrush Town Councils are also heading for the states.

The total cost is expected to be just over 6,000 euro.

Mayor of Clare Councillor Pat Daly say these journeys are vital to develop cultural and business links which he hopes will be of wider benefit to the county.
